INTRODUCTION TO DATA CUBES
All Causes of Death, Australia (3303.0) publication tables are available in these spreadsheets. The spreadsheets also include some data that has appeared in previous publications and additional time series information.

Main features are provided in the 'Summary' tab. Explanatory notes, abbreviations and a glossary of terms can be accessed through the 'Explanatory Notes' tab.

Each worksheet in the files contains one table. There are 24 tables in total and these are listed below.
